pub async fn execute(&self) -> Result<()> {
let start_time = Instant::now();
let result = match &self.job_fn {
JobFunction::Sync(job_fn) => {
let job_fn = job_fn.clone();
tokio::task::spawn_blocking(move || job_fn()).await
.map_err(|e| Error::custom(format!("Job execution failed: {}", e)))?
}
JobFunction::Async(job_fn) => {
job_fn().await
}
};
if let Some(timeout) = self.metadata.timeout {
if start_time.elapsed() > timeout {
return Err(Error::timeout(format!(
"Job '{}' exceeded timeout of {:?}",
self.name, timeout
)));
}
}
result
}
#[cfg(feature = "tokio")]
pub async fn execute_with_retries(&self) -> JobResult {
let started_at = Instant::now();
let mut last_error = None;
for attempt in 0..=self.metadata.max_retries {
let _attempt_start = Instant::now();
match self.execute().await {
Ok(_) => {
return JobResult {
success: true,
error: None,
duration: started_at.elapsed(),
started_at,
completed_at: Instant::now(),
};
}
Err(e) => {
last_error = Some(e.to_string());
if attempt < self.metadata.max_retries {
let delay = Duration::from_secs(2_u64.pow(attempt));
tokio::time::sleep(delay).await;
}
}
}
}
JobResult {
success: false,
error: last_error,
duration: started_at.elapsed(),
started_at,
completed_at: Instant::now(),
}
}
